Bulk Mustard Movement Inches Forward

PANAMA - Dec 3/16 - SNS -- The Canadian Grain Commission (CGC) reports 1,200 metric tons (MT) mustard seed were loaded for export through licensed terminal and primary elevators which are required to report to it all grain movement in October.

The CGC data does not include exports in containers or from non-reporting terminals. It is important to recall that the CGC data may not match official export data. The CGC counts product when it is loaded to ships, while Statistics Canada bases its calculations on the bill of lading date.

The CGC reports exports are identical to the 1,200 MT shipped the same month last year but down from the 1,500 MT loaded for export the previous month.
